Built in 1854, this Hotel is reported to be one of the first purpose built hotels in Ireland. ** PLEASE NOTE THE SWIMMING POOL WILL BE CLOSED 01/01/08 - 11/05/08 AND 01/09/08 - 31/12/08 **(RT08/07) A bright modern 4 storey building. Set in the town of Cobh, County Cork, overlooking one of the world natural harbours, it is formally known as Queenstown. Queenstown was the centre of the Irish emigration of the last port of call of The Titanic.
